History of PHP

First, the PHP language was created in 1995. That means PHP can be considered as a language that has been created in almost timeless times. The Founder is Rasmus Lerdorf, he is a computer programmer.


He developed a Perl/CGI based program to acquire the number of visitors he had visited and to display his page on his own web page.

This was a time when the Web was a primary one. Many people who saw this capability on his website sent him e-mails and asked how he gave this capability.

It's all for free, to give it a personal computer program, and it's called Personal Home Page (PHP). Today, we have the ability to use PHP without any money.


He also developed further programs based on the enthusiasm of those people, and worked on Perl based program in C, and he developed PHP 2.0 in a web-based HTML Form in 1997. Its named PHP / FI (Personal Home Page / Form Interpreter)

By this time, he and other programmers were gathering together to help him develop this new PHP language. But he never removed his original notion of HTML and interaction. Accordingly, we have the ability to create web pages today with PHP and HTML.


By 1998, the programmers were able to present a version of PHP 3.0 with a rewritten core. By that time, more than 50,000 people had used this new language on their own websites.
